Julian Foye is a family furnishing business, started in the town of Fowey in 1862. In the early years, furniture arrived on the railway, packaged in straw and hessian, and was wheeled to the shop on a hand cart.
It is a very different business today but still a family firm.
Mike Ellis, who has built the business seen today, now shares
the running of it with his daughters Annette and Julie. They are
backed by an enthusiastic, dedicated staff, many of whom have
been with the firm for over 20 years. There are large furniture
showrooms at Truro (19,200 sq ft), St. Austell (21,500 sqft) and
Wadebridge (7,700 sq ft) and a smaller shop at Fowey.
The range at all shops includes lounge suites, beds, carpets and curtains.
